The level of transport efficiency is an important index to measure the transport development of a national or a regional From developing transportation industry in 1980s to developing a comprehensive plan in 2010s, transportation has become an important part of economic development in Jiangsu. Sustainable development has become a guiding ideology of formulating economic and social development strategy in Jiangsu province. Transport development should follow this guiding ideology, improve resource utilization efficiency.Firstly, in reviewing of the theory about efficiency, this article explains economic efficiency and transport efficiency respectively, analyzes the inputs and outputs status of transport sectors in Jiangsu province, depicts the context and the key sector of transport system in Jiangsu province, analyzes the status and role of each means of transport in the transport system at different periods, analyzes policy orientation of the transportation industry development at different times.Secondly, using fixed assets’investment and number of employees as input index, passenger turnover and freight turnover as output index, evaluating the transport efficiency of each transportation department in Jiangsu province by DEA,estimating the DEA efficiency index and Malmquist efficiency index.At last, analyzing the basic status of transport efficiency in Jiangsu province, discoursing the problem of each transportation department through empirical research. According to the questions make policy recommendations; such as:doing the preparatory work of reform, accelerating infrastructure construction, integration of transport resources for improving technical efficiency, changing in government functions,changing management model, improving the coordination mechanism, establishing a new integrated transport management system, etc.
